Top 3 Best Value Colleges for General Biomedical Sciences (Income $30-$48k) in Minnesota
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ota For Those Making $30-$48k that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Minnesota - Duluth landed the #1 spot on the list. University of Minnesota - Duluth is a fairly large school located in Duluth, Minnesota that handed out 2 ’s general biomedical sciences degrees in 2019-2020.
UMN Duluth also took the #2 spot in our “Best General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for University of Minnesota - Duluth is $7,992 for minnesota biomedical sciences students whose families make $30-$48k.
The low student loan default rate of 3.1%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ota For Those Making $30-$48k that were part of this year’s ranking, Saint Cloud State University landed the #2 spot on the list. St. Cloud State University is a fairly large public school situated in Saint Cloud, Minnesota. It awarded 54 ’s general biomedical sciences degrees in 2019-2020.
St. Cloud State University also made our “Best General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ota” list, coming in at #1. The estimated yearly cost for Saint Cloud State University is $11,274 for Minnesota Biomedical Sciences students whose families make $30-$48k.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Minnesota State University - Moorhead. It ranked #3 on our 2022 Best Value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ota For Those Making $30-$48k list. MSU Moorhead is a medium-sized school located in Moorhead, Minnesota that handed out 30 ’s general biomedical sciences degrees in 2019-2020.
MSU Moorhead also made our “Best General Biomedical Sciences Schools in Minnesota” list, coming in at #3. The yearly cost to attend Minnesota State University - Moorhead is $12,279 for Minnesota Biomedical Sciences students whose families make $30-$48k.
The school has an impressive student loan default rate. It’s only 4.5%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.
